网站源代码抓取工具的概述
网站源代码抓取工具,顾名思义,是指用于获取网站源代码的工具。这些工具可以帮助用户快速获取网站的源代码,以便进行后续的数据分析、网站开发、网络爬虫等操作。
网站源代码抓取工具的分类
根据功能和使用场景的不同,网站源代码抓取工具可以分为以下几类:
1. 浏览器开发者工具:如Chrome开发者工具、Firefox开发者工具等,这些工具可以方便地查看网页源代码,并提供了丰富的调试功能。
2. 网络抓包工具:如Wireshark、Fiddler等,这些工具可以捕获网站的数据包,从而获取网站的源代码。
3. 爬虫框架:如Python的Scrapy、Java的Selenium等,这些框架可以帮助用户编写爬虫程序,自动抓取网站的源代码。
4. 专用抓取工具:针对特定网站或特定需求开发的专用抓取工具,如针对电商网站的商品抓取工具等。
使用方法及注意事项
1. 选择合适的工具:根据实际需求选择合适的抓取工具,如需要调试网页时可以选择浏览器开发者工具,需要自动抓取大量数据时可以选择爬虫框架。
2. 遵守法律法规:在使用抓取工具时,应遵守相关法律法规和道德规范,不得进行恶意攻击、窃取他人信息等违法行为。
3. 注意网站反爬机制:部分网站会设置反爬机制以防止恶意抓取,如验证码验证、IP封禁等。在使用抓取工具时,应注意这些机制的存在,并采取相应措施避免被封禁。
4. 尊重网站版权:在抓取和使用网站源代码时,应尊重网站的版权和知识产权,不得用于非法用途。